Is F1 pit crew a full time job?

Members of the pit crew have full-time jobs as part of their racing team. Many of these members are mechanics, truck drivers, engine fitters, and more. If you’re looking to get involved in a Formula One pit crew, you’ll need to start off by getting involved in the race team with a regular day job, such as a mechanic.

How many F1 pit crews are there?

20 people
More than 20 people make up the F1 pit crew. They are responsible for stabilising the car, changing the tyres, making adjustments to the aerodynamics, and safely releasing the car. Each team has one pit crew that services both cars throughout the weekend.

How many pit crews are allowed over the wall?

five
Each NASCAR pit crew contains up to eight members in various roles, with only five being allowed over the wall during any given pit stop. The Crew Chief calls the shots a top the box.

Why do F1 pit crew wear helmets?

Working in the pits is incredibly dangerous. It’s not unusual for pit workers to get clipped or even run over by race cars, or to be hit by errant equipment, such as a tire coming off a car or a flying air line. There’s also the risk of fire. Helmets are necessary safety equipment for a very dangerous job.

How much do Formula 1 teams get paid?

F1 share column two payments through the top 10 teams depending on how they finish in the current constructors’ championship. Teams who finish outside the top ten get a column three payment which is around $10 million just for being part of Formula 1. All 11 teams earn transportation costs.
